Read aloud to memory care residents next door to the library! Many elderly people are no longer able to read for themselves, but love to hear stories and it means so much to them when our volunteers go over with a light and funny book to read to them! This volunteer position is bi weekly or once a month, depending on your availability and will take 30 minutes each visit.

Mission Statement
Support the greater Grand Forks area by creating an environment where lifelong habits of learning, self-improvement, and self-expression are encouraged, in an environment where patrons can meet their educational, informational and recreational needs.
Description
The Volunteers of Campbell Library:
- support the Library’s summer programming for children
- sponsor special programming including the library’s special cultural events, contests, and author presentations
- present scholarships to High School Seniors
- support volunteer-ism enhancing our Library’s services
- maintain the endowment for Campbell Library
- operate a used book store just inside the library entrance
